我的包 Json 看起来像这样:
{
"name": "project",
"version": "1.0.0",
"description": "",
"main": "server.js",
"scripts": {
"lint": "./node_modules/eslint/bin/eslint.js --format \"./node_modules/eslint-friendly-formatter/index.js\" .",
"build:server": "./node_modules/babel-cli/bin/babel.js . -d dist/server --ignore node_modules,dist,client,public,webpack*"
}
}
正如您所看到的,lint
和 build:server
命令很难读,因此我想将它们分成多行。
我尝试使用 \
,但它会出现以下错误:
npm ERR! Failed to parse json
npm ERR! Unexpected token ' ' at 11:80
npm ERR! :server": "./node_modules/babel-cli/bin/babel.js . -d dist/server \
npm ERR! ^
我怎么能这么做?
只是编写另一个 bash 文件,如 build.sh
,并使用它在 npm 脚本,如 ./build.sh server
?